So I'm a rising junior who loves graphic design, and also have this desire to serve in the military. Does anyone know which branch might offer opportunities for someone interested in graphic design? It seems like a unique path, but I'd love to bring together my passion for design and service together.
While it might not be the first career you associate with the military, the different branches indeed have numerous opportunities for individuals with artistic talents, including graphic design. Here are some possibilities:
1. U.S. Air Force Multimedia Illustrator: These individuals work on a variety of visual media projects, ranging from designing posters and logos to creating video production sets and developing websites.
2. U.S. Army Public Affairs Specialist: This role offers an opportunity to work on various communication materials - brochures, newsletters, social media content, etc., many of which require design skills.
3. U.S. Navy Mass Communication Specialist: Mass Communication Specialists in the Navy creates and designs graphic materials, taking photos, and potentially working in radio or television broadcasting.
4. U.S. Marine Corps Combat Camera: This role is primarily more photography and video based, but there's definitely an element of design involved, especially when it comes to editing media materials.
Choosing the right branch may depend on other factors like your physical fitness, desired commitment level, and whether there are specific locations or missions you're interested in. Whichever branch you choose, be assured that there's a place for art and design in the military, and your skills can have a significant impact.
